Greg Kroah-Hartman announced a few hours ago, November 5, the immediate availability for download of the sixth maintenance release for the stable Linux 3.6 kernel series.

Looking at the raw changelog, we can see that Linux kernel 3.6.6 brings some improvements to the Nouveau video driver for Nvidia video cards, fixes an EXT4 filesystem bug, and it updates various other drivers.

“I'm announcing the release of the 3.6.6 kernel. All users of the 3.6 kernel series must upgrade.”

“The updated 3.6.y git tree can be found at: git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/stable/linux-stable.git linux-3.6.y and can be browsed at the normal kernel.org git web browser: http://git.kernel.org/?p=linux/kernel/git/stable/linux-stable.git;a=summary” said Greg KH in the email announcement.
